By definition, Economic Systems are the way countries and governments distribute resources, goods and services. The aim of Economic Systems is to provide food and work for people around the world. Subjects typically taught in Economic Systems programs include Econometrics, Development Policy, Money and Finance, Environmental Economics, Behavioral Economics, Foreign Investment, Markets in Developing Countries, Advanced Micro and Macroeconomics, Economic Analysis, Management Basics, Business Evaluation, Statistics, Accounting and more. Students learn to analyze the market and consumer behavior, and improve the functioning of businesses and organizations. They gain understanding of various economic problems, and develop valuable skills like the ability to deal with logistical and management issues, decision-making skills, advertising skills, as well as the ability to analyze and assess the market and client, meet customer needs, create strategies and different approaches, coordinate tasks, as well as manage finances and resources. Economic Systems graduates can find work in public or private organizations and companies and pursue careers in economic assistance, system administration, marketing, research and evaluation, economic development, insurance advising, health care, consultancy and more.
